Hey guys when I run this command: bin/datomic -Xmx4g -Xms4g backup-db "file:///Users/ertugrulcetin/Desktop/backup-dir" "datomic:
I get this error: :storage/invalid-uri Unsupported protocol: datomic
any ideas?
@ertucetin looks like you reversed the args for backup-db, should be from-db-uri to-backup-uri
@terjesb oww let me try like that then
@terjesb it worked thanks!, silly mistake 😕

Hi all, I have a question about schema naming conventions. Say I have an entity defn :metadata/tags
that is a reference type with cardinality many and is also configured as a component. The components items for this reference entity are individual content tags. I'm unclear what's the best way to name the tags. Currently, I'm thinking of this:
{:db/ident :metadata/tags
:db/valueType :db.type/ref
:db/cardinality :db.cardinality/many
:db/isComponent true}
{:db/ident :tag
:db/valueType :db.type/keyword
:db/cardinality :db.cardinality/one
:db/index true}
{:db/ident :empty}
Is there a better way to setup the naming here?{:metadata/tags [{:tag/name "the-name" :tag/whatever "foo"} ...]
is the design I would expect @ezmiller77
